In Illinois, the obligation to support a child ends when the child turns 18 unless the child is still attending high school full-time, in which case it continues until the child turns 19 or graduates from high school, whichever happens first. In income shares states, the court bases the child support payment on the income of both parents and the number of children. For example, if a non-custodial parent has a net income of $2,500 a month and the custodial parent has an income of $2,000 a month, the parents’ total monthly income is $4,500, Using an economic table that shows the expected cost of raising children, the court will determine that the total monthly child support obligation is $1,125 for one child. In the United States, states regulate the payment of child support through civil statutes but use different formulas for calculating child support. If a basic child support obligation would bring a noncustodial parent's income to below the New York State Self-Support Reserve ($16,862 annual income) then the noncustodial parent is generally ordered to pay $50 per month in child support or the difference between their income and the self-support reserve, if that difference is greater than $50.
